Two sides who find themselves scrapping it out at the foot of the National League South table, Aveley will welcome Salisbury to Essex on Monday night.

Starting with the hosts, while Aveley might have opened up the 2024/25 campaign with their sights set on mounting another play-off charge, the Millers have endeared a National League South nightmare this time around. Sat rock-bottom of the table and shockingly pencilled in as a landslide relegation contender this year, Danny Scopes’ camp open Monday’s showdown sat 10 points adrift of safety. Last seen over the weekend slumping to a 2-1 loss at home against Hampton & Richmond, the Essex-based outfit have lost each of their previous four appearances by an aggregate score of 11-3. Hit with a woeful 4-1 drumming at the hands of Weymouth last month, Aveley have also registered just three points from any of their last eight National League South matchups. Likewise, already shipping 65 goals so far this season, it should also be highlighted that the Blues hold the third-worst defensive tally in the division.

As for the visitors, although Salisbury might have only made their National League South return this season, the Whites are sat in the driving seat to keep hold of their sixth-tier status in 2025. However, despite opening Monday’s trip to Essex holding a four-point buffer over the drop zone, Brian Dutton’s men are enduring their own recent struggle. Last seen over the weekend suffering a late collapse as they eventually fell to an action-packed 3-2 loss away at play-off contenders Maidstone, the former Walsall boss has seen his squad lose each of their previous three appearances by an aggregate score of 8-5. In fact, mustering just a sole point from any of their last five National League South outings, the Wiltshire-based outfit have shown some glaring defensive struggles. Including a 3-1 defeat at home against Chelmsford on February 15th, Salisbury have conceded 13 goals on their five-match winless rut.
